Output 8ea089524e0e81edbe00efb7153f32190adf24b2f5c62954394075ff45e7ce02:44

value
811966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0df8fc15241c2e700cab50c91d90f3488130b54d OP_EQUAL
address
32xtyoDTRyML7qCA1an6UmbzgtabzfAH81
transaction
8ea089524e0e81edbe00efb7153f32190adf24b2f5c62954394075ff45e7ce02
spent
true